The community at a glance
Port Community is a Slack Group for DevOps Engineers and Programmers with roughly 750 members. It has a live chat communication style. It also includes member perks or discounts, an email newsletter, and courses or structured learning. On the Hive Index it ranks #6 in the DevOps communities list.

- What platform is Port Community on?
- Port Community runs on Slack. Slack is a business communication platform which offers many realtime chat features, including persistent chat rooms (channels) organized by topic, private groups, and direct messaging. Slack is popular as a company communication tool, but offers realtime communication functionality to other types of communities as well.
